New World's Halloween 2023 event called Nightveil Hallow has brought back the evil Baalphazu Boss that players can beat in order to stop from spreading a living nightmare across Aeternum and earn new armor pieces (5 times daily), costumes (3 times daily), and Ichor. Here are the exact locations of Baalphazu in the New World, along with tips to defeat it.

Baalphazu boss will spawn in six different regions as part of the Nightveil Hallow Halloween event, and they are listed below:

  • Great Cleave
  • Edengrove
  • Weaver’s Fen
  • Brightwood
  • Ebonscale Reach
  • Mourningdale

The locations where the boss spawns are marked by purple icons on the map, and you can have a look at the exact locations marked on the New World interactive map below:

To activate the Baalphazu quest, you need to speak to Salvatore, who is standing next to a giant cauldron in any city on the map.

How To Defeat Baalphazu In New World

To defeat Baalphazu, you need to fight through several waves of mobs. Pick up the pumpkin heads they drop, and throw them at Baalphazu to break his stamina bar. Then you can damage him when he falls to the ground. Baalphazu has over 23 million health and high resistance to physical and elemental damage, so you will need a large group or several groups to defeat him.

Baalphazu has several attacks that you need to watch out for, and you can dodge or block them or use potions or food to mitigate the damage. You can also use weapons or abilities that deal void damage, as Baalphazu is weak to this type of damage.

After you defeat Baalphazu, you need to return to town and dump the ichor he drops into the cauldron. This will give you a reward, as well as an event reputation that you can use to buy multiple in-game items.
